Description

LOUIS XVI-STYLE DESK By Sormani In mahogany and mahogany veneer, decorated with chased and gilded bronze, the waist opening by a drawer bearing a plaque engraved Vve P. SORMANI & FILS/ 10 rue Charlot/PARIS, the waist with scrolls on either side of a reserve decorated with a foliage cartouche, the sheathed legs joined by a spacer with interlacing and ending in spinning tops;fitted with a removable glass top (not illustrated). H.:74.5 cm (29 ¼ in.) L.:130 cm (51 ¼ in.) P.:80 cm (31 ½ in.) A Louis XVI style gilt-bronze and mahogany bureau plat, by Sormani 3 000 - 5 000 € The business of Paul Sormani (1817-1877) was taken over after his death by his son and widow under the name Sormani veuve, Paul et fils, at 10 rue Charlot in Paris, until 1886, when Madame Sormani died. The company moved to 134, boulevard Haussmann, in 1912, when they joined forces with Thiébaux.
